Highlights
Father was a whip in Ireland and continued working with horses once he moved to the United States; as a child, Conway once dreamed of becoming a jockey.
Served in the U.S. Army for two years following college.
Early comedy partner was Ernie Anderson, director Paul Thomas Anderson's father.
Comedian Rose Marie discovered Conway at a local Cleveland television station and arranged for him to audition for
The Steve Allen Show
.
Changed name to Tim so as not to be confused with British actor Tom Conway.
Co-founder of the Don MacBeth Memorial Jockey Fund, which aids disabled jockeys.
